Data Scientist – Long-Term Contract

Location: Germany – Berlin, Cologne, Frankfurt, Düsseldorf, Munich, Hamburg or Stuttgart

Contract: Long-term contract, duration TBC

Language: Fluent German – mandatory

Working Model: Client-site focused (Hybrid)

Engagement: EOR / Employee Contract

Pay Rate: €600–€900 per day


About the Opportunity

We are looking for an experienced Data Scientist to join a long-term AI and technology programme supporting leading organisations across industries including Pharma & Life Sciences, Energy, and Financial Services.

This is a highly hands-on role for someone who enjoys building and delivering practical data science solutions rather than managing teams. You will be part of a talent pool and matched with suitable client assignments based on your skills, experience, and expertise.


Key Responsibilities

  • Develop practical machine learning and data science solutions using Python
  • Perform data processing, analysis, and transformation using Python
  • Build, train, test, and evaluate machine learning models
  • Write and optimise SQL queries for data extraction and analysis
  • Perform feature engineering, model evaluation, and statistical analysis
  • Work with stakeholders and technical teams to translate business problems into data-driven solutions
  • Deploy and support data science solutions within real-world client environments
  • Communicate technical findings and model outputs clearly to both technical and non-technical stakeholders


Essential Skills & Experience

  • 4–10 years of professional experience in Data Science / Machine Learning
  • Strong, hands-on Python experience
  • Strong SQL skills
  • Practical experience with Machine Learning, including building, training, testing, and evaluating models
  • Experience working with real-world datasets and developing production-oriented data science solutions
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Comfortable working as an individual contributor in client-facing environments
  • Fluent German is mandatory


Important Information

  • This is not a managerial role; strong hands-on technical experience is essential
  • Candidates will work on client assignments based on their skills and experience
  • If an assignment requires travel to another city, travel and accommodation expenses will be covered separately, in addition to the agreed package
  • Candidates are paid their agreed daily rate whether actively assigned to a client project or on the bench
  • A technical assessment via HackerRank will form part of the selection process
  • Candidates will be hired through an EOR arrangement


Travel Requirements

Candidates should be open to one of the following travel arrangements, depending on their preference:

  • Up to 80% travel, including cross-border travel
  • Up to 80% travel, within Germany only
  • 40–60% travel, including cross-border travel
  • 40–60% travel, within Germany only
